New pharmacy opens for business in Rathdowney

A new pharmacy will open for business in Rathdowney today – in the unit adjacent to Breslin’s SuperValu and the Post Office in the town.

The premises was previously occupied by Frawley’s Pharmacy but has been vacant for the past couple of years.

Clarke’s Care Plus Pharmacy is owned by Elaine Clarke, who will be the managing pharmacist.

The young pharmacist has years of experience in the industry with her most recent post in the O’Rourke’s All Care pharmacy in Monasterevin in Kildare.

Work has been underway for the last couple of months stocking and fitting out the unit. The new shop is set to create a number of new full-time and part-time jobs.

Care Plus Pharmacy is “the fastest growing consumer retail brand in the independent pharmacy sector in Ireland”.

It brings the number of pharmacies in the town to two. Flynn’s Medical Hall is based on the town’s Main Street.
